Default Working on a 63 Lemans, looking for parts

Hello all! My name is Mike. I am working on a 1963 Pontiac Lemans for a customer. The car is pretty clean and completely rust free, but it needs some mechanical attention, and apparently parts are unobtanium for these things!

At present, I am looking for
-steering idler arm and bracket (has some play)
-power steering control valve (has lots of play)
-transmission pan gasket and filter

I found one company that can rebuild the control valve, so worst case I can do that, but the idler arm and bracket don't seem to be available anywhere. I can find ones for a 61-62, but I don't know what the difference is, or if they are interchangable.

Anyway, if anyone has any parts sources, or knows what my options are here, let me know. Thanks!

The steering on the 63 Tempest is a power ASSISTED unit like used on early Corvettes and I think Mustangs.I had a Corvette shop local to me do the steering.FYI!When you get it done keep your hand away from the steering wheel when you start the car for the first time.The wheel can spin wildly one way or the other.Join the Little Indians site,many on there should be able to help you.Tom

As mentioned, Rare parts for Idler or Kanter Auto Parts in NJ or search Ebay,there's always several NOS Idler arms or kits on there.

https://www.kanter.com/

I used Lares to rebuild my control valve 10 years ago, still works great!

https://www.larescorp.com/

Fatsco Transmissons in NJ has your pan gasket, maybe screen as well. 62 uses a screen not a filter, not sure what they used in 63. should be able to clean out the screen/filter
